'Kohi' Defends Title; Kraus Shocks Buakaw at K-1 World Max Japan TOKYO, February 23, 2005 -- Thirty-two year-old Takayuki Kohiruimaki fought his way past three challengers to win the World Max Japan 2005 at the Ariake Coliseum in Tokyo tonight. 'Kohi' picks up six million yen for the feat, and advances to the K-1 World Max 2005 Final, set for this May 4.

K-1 World Max Japan 2005 Press Conference TOKYO, February 22, 2005 -- With public interest in K-1's 70kg World Max fighting class at an all-time, more than 100 media reps from Japan, Korea, Europe, Oceania and the Americas filled a press conference today at the Shin Takanawa Hotel to get a look at the eight fighters who will battle in the World Max Japan 2005.

From Dream Stage Entertainment February 21, 2005 TOKYO , Japan representing Poland as well as the martial art of Judo will be legendary Judoka, Pawel Nastula. The 1995 and 1997 Judo World Champion and 1996 gold medallist at the Olympic games in Atlanta , Nastula brings his legendary Judo skills to the PRIDE ring to compete against the world's elite mixed martial artists.

TOKYO, Japan Stefan Leko versus Kazuhiro Nakamura has been added to PRIDE FIGHTINGS FISTS OF FIRE fight card. Representing team Golden Glory out of Holland, the German-born Stefan Blitz Leko is a world-class kick boxer. He has garnered numerous kick boxing titles and championships and is now making the transition to mixed martial arts. Kazuhiro Nakamura represents the Yoshida Dojo and is the protégé of Judo legend and 1992 Judo Olympic gold medallist, Hidehiko Yoshida. Thus far in his career, Nakamura boasts victories over the likes of Daniel Gracie and Murilo Bustamante.

TOKYO, Japan Kiyoshi Tamura versus Aliev Makhmud has been added to PRIDE FIGHTINGS FISTS OF FIRE fight card. A mixed martial arts veteran, Tamura is one of Japans heroes and is making his return to the PRIDE ring. Makhmud is fighting out of Azerbaydzhan and boasts in impressive wrestling background.

Dana White announced the UFC 52 card at the UFC 51 Post fight Press conference and so far the card looks like this... Randy Couture vs. Chuck Liddell Georges St. Pierre vs. Jason Miller Patrick Cote vs. Lee Murray Matt Hughes vs. Frank Trigg

TOKYO, Japan Three more matches have been announced for PRIDE FIGHTINGS FISTS OF FIRE fight card: Japans up and coming heavyweight, Hirotaka Yokoi, will take on the leader of the Brazilian Top Team, Mario Sperry
mixed martial arts veteran Hiromitsu Kanehara goes head to head with Chute Boxe star Mauricio Shogun Rua
Tom Big Cat Erickson makes his return to PRIDE versus newcomer Fabricio Werdum of Spain.
